TRIP HIGHLIGHTS

A single tourist sitting in front of Cambodia’s Pyramid temple, Koh Ker
Marvel at Cambodia’s Pyramid temple
Step into Cambodia's mysterious past at Koh Ker's remarkable Pyramid temple, a hidden archaeological wonder rising seven tiers above the jungle canopy. This optional extension to your small-group Kulen Mountain Tour takes you to Prasat Thom, where you can climb the ancient stone steps for breathtaking panoramic vistas of the surrounding wilderness. Built in the 10th century as the short-lived Khmer capital, Koh Ker remains one of Cambodia's least visited temple sites, offering an intimate encounter with history far from tourist crowds.

Frequently Asked Questions

There are various types of tickets available for visiting Angkor Park, depending on the duration of your visit. The most commonly chosen ticket is the one-day pass, which is currently priced at $37. However, if you intend to stay longer, you have the option to purchase a three-day pass for $62 or a seven-day pass for $72.

Itinerary

Travel throughout Cambodia with your guide in an air-conditioned van, with stops along the way to various historical sites and temples. Be picked up from your hotel at 5 AM or 6 AM and travel to the north of Cambodia. Once you arrive near the Thai border, see Preah Vihear, the most spectacular mountain temple in Cambodia. Learn from your guide how the World Heritage Site was built in the 11th century during the Khmer Empire. Explore the cliff it's located on top of in the Dângrêk Mountains, and take in the lush forest below it. See captivating views of the countryside, and the temple in its distance.

Next, stop for lunch on the way to the Koh Ker archaeological site before continuing on to Chok Gargyar, another ancient Khmer city. Finally, you'll reach the much-anticipated visit to the historical city, Chok Gargyar. See three spectacular temples in Koh Ker's archaeological site, including Prasat Thom (the Pyramid temple), Prasat Kroes Linga, and Prasat Prum temple.

Contine to Beng Melea, the mysterious 12th-century temple in the middle of the jungle. This temple is heavily overgrown with vegetation, trees, lianas, and mosses. This temple is surrounded by a rainforest due to it being abundant for over 300 years. When it is not fully restored, many local and international tourists fall in love with the area. Return to Siem Reap city.
